West accused of avoiding open debate in Middle East talks

Khrushchev pressed for a Big Five Europe summit while rejecting a UN Security Council meeting. He urged Eisenhower respond quickly and accused Britain and the U S of aiming to widen the conflict. De Gaulle supported a Western unity approach as Dulles signaled closer ties with the Baghdad Pact nations.

Summit Meeting Near Says Prime Minister Menzies

Prime Minister Menzies said a New York summit meeting is likely to be held at the United Nations headquarters. He noted British PM Macmillan proposed a plan to involve the WLM Security Council in a summit and expects a full Middle East settlement to be the first business after the debate on the government statement next Wednesday and Thursday.

U N Criticism of Trust Unrealistic Says Mr Calwell

Australian Federal Parliamentarian Calwell with Bryant and Luchelti toured New Guinea and urged patience on its future status. He pressed more airstrips, funds for education, a Port Moresby or Rabaul university college, and rapid airfield construction by an RAF unit. He backed three battalions for the Pacific Island Regiment. UN council praised Australia for handling high population density and shifting to a cash economy while noting education gaps and illiteracy. It urged cooperative credit development and a separate Department of Cooperatives consideration.

Fear Of Mobs In Bangkok

Thai Police Department spokesimin warned of possible mob activity after admitting an underground Communist Party revival within Thailand. The party reportedly distributes anti US and anti British pamphlets as Prime Minister Ki tukchorn vows continued Thai troop presence to deter Chinese moves amid shifting Middle East tensions.

Record Crowded Canberra Hospital Sets Inmate Milestone

The Canberra Community Hospital housed 217 inmates yesterday, beating prior records by eight. For the first time the obstetrics ward was used to accommodate mothers, with a record 47 mothers in hospital though the ward capacity is 45.

Menzies Rejects Canberra Housing Criticism As Nonsense

Prime Minister Menzies dismissed Canberra housing criticism as petty and foolish. He argued five bedroom homes for Service chiefs may be built while departments move, noting ministers could live there if needed and rents would reflect accommodation type. He favored developing Canberra as a city of dignity.
